ABE well-represented among Learning Communities and Residential Academic Initiatives honorees

Learning communities (LCs) and learning community instructors (LCIs) provide a key method of integration into the Purdue community for first-year students. More than 3,700 Boilermakers participated in 61 LCs in Fall 2017.

Favorite Faculty awards recognize distinguished faculty for success in academics, research, service, and teaching. The Distinguished Faculty for Research honoree is Bernard Engel.

The Most Outstanding Faculty award is given to a faculty member who demonstrates strength on the pillars of service, research, and teaching. The honoree is Kevin Solomon.

Dr. Dennis Buckmaster received the Exceptional Event Planner Award for Agriculture Technology and Innovation.

Margaret Hegwood was honored with the Student Staff Advocate award "for displaying an uncommon commitment to learning, taking exceptional involvement within their learning community, and providing outstanding opportunities for connection outside the classroom.
